Tips On Data Storage Housekeeping

November 7, 2010

Data storage housekeeping is a crucial part of regular system maintenance. It is done to make sure that your whole network of systems or individual systems run smoothly. There are several important elements of data storage housekeeping that should be addressed properly. Below are some of the points that should be regularly taken care of.

  • Backup administration – Keeping the proper back-ups of data is the most important task for all networks. The data back-up can be done in compressed form so that it does not hamper daily operations of network system.
  • Anti-virus update – For obvious reasons, anti -virus system needs to be up-dated. One of the issues with it is the hard drive space used by the updates. It is advised to periodically uninstall the anti-virus and reinstall with updated version to free up the updated space.
  • Operating system updates – In comparison to new updated version of operating system,  regularly updated (over years) operating system software consumes a lot of hard drive space. It is important to safely remove the debris from the past updates so that you can create some free space on your hard drive. You can do so by reviewing and renewing the operating system.
  • Old archive data – Archives are created in order to back up data so that it can be used when needed. Most of the times the archived files stay on the computer system for long, even when they are of no use. As a result they consume considerable hard drive space. To release up the hard drive space, these archived files should be removed from the hard drive to other storage devices. Even if they are to be kept on the system, they should be stored in compressed form.
  • Email boxes – It is important to regularly monitor email folders on the server to remove the unwanted emails/ junk mails/ attachments that consume server space.
  • Unused software – Softwares that run in background but practically are of no use should be removed from the system. Such softwares can affect the performance of the system.
  • File saving – It is important to save the files in proper folders with correct names. Doing so will make sure that you can easily retrieve the data from archived files/ folders latter on.
  • Keep it tidy – All files and folders should be kept in a simple, easy to retrieve structure. This is important to make sure that you or anyone else who uses your system can conveniently access the files when needed.

Understanding The Need For Advanced Security Systems for Corporates

April 26, 2010

The internet has become an indispensable part of business operations. It helps in ensuring better control and management through convenient communication and smooth functioning. However, it also brings a risk of virus attacks and data theft with its use. When your network is infiltrated, your corporate activities are sure to be affected.

Such issues make it essential for corporate entities to invest in strong IT security systems. Not only does it protect your business information but also prevents many financial losses. Unfortunately, many business organizations do not understand the need for full fledged security systems. For them, installing antivirus software is enough to deal with all sorts of virtual threats. This kind of negligence often leads to hacking of business security systems and disruption of important operations.

Gradually, the government is also realizing the importance of having robust security measures for corporate systems. Several laws and regulations have been put up for businesses in the private as well as government sector. Still, it is vital to think about the capability of your corporate’s IT security system and ensure that it can safeguard your database against all potential attacks.

If you are starting afresh or find scope for improvement in your business security, the first step is to fix quantifiable security measures. Also, you need to match them with your corporate goals in order to avoid conflict. It is also important that the security system makes your business identity and market presence stronger.

For many companies, it is a nightmare to lose all their data, be it business emails or invoices. Such a disaster can be avoided by implementing foolproof security systems with the help of latest Information Technology tools and techniques. In the ever changing world of Internet, your data needs to be protected from outsider as well as insider misuse.

A good way of dealing with security problems is to hire a security expert. Companies that cannot afford to do this can take appropriate measures for securing their data. This includes making weekly backups, replacing obsolete computer hardware and software and of course, updating your security software regularly.

Advantages of Web Based Content Management System.

Dec 14, 2009

CMS or Content Management System is a web program created to manage content of a website. Through CMS, a person with no technical skills can easily administer his or her website. CMS is a much better option for your organization if it does not have a HTML or some other related web scripting language skills.

Various Advantages Of Using a Content Management System (CMS)

  • CMS programs give you the freedom to make necessary changes in your content without hiring a programmer for the same. Even if you don’t have knowledge of any HTML language you can make changes like editing, deleting, modifying and removing any content you want from a website with much ease yourself.
  • More often than not there are few differences in the features of content management system but revision control, index, management of format, web publishing and retrieval are present in all CMS. If you are familiar with functioning of one CMS, you can easily handle most of the CMS programs available.
  • CMS’s proper usage can convert any weak website into a profit yielding website. In fact it is the best way available for a website to stay alive in the contemporary online competition. With the help of CMS you can regularly edit and add content to your website. An up-to-date and attractive content gives you an upper hand over your rivals.
  • CMS helps a website yield positive returns with the help of proper and effective management of content. It even helps in bringing down the operating cost consequently increasing profits. You are able to make the necessary changes yourself so you don’t need to pay the programmer to make a change to your website.
  • With the proper execution of Content Management System the working within the organization as well as with the customers becomes smoother.
  • With its intellectual usage, work history and accountability of the entire content system can be maintained. It can specifically differentiate and give you a closer look of the changes made in the content and the frequency as well.
  • With the help of this system a professional looking website can be managed hence making it a big success online. It is even helpful in preserving uniformity of the web pages of your website to a chosen point.
